Instrumentation, OP Amps, Buffer Amps Analog Devices, Inc. LT1179SW#PBF Overview

The LT1179SW#PBF by Analog Devices, Inc. is a highly versatile integrated circuit operational amplifier designed for general-purpose applications. With its four op-amp circuits packed into a 16SO package, this IC offers exceptional performance and flexibility in various electronic systems.

Engineered with precision and reliability in mind, the LT1179SW#PBF is an ideal choice for engineers and designers seeking high-quality amplification solutions for their projects. Its compact size and low power consumption make it suitable for a wide range of applications, from instrumentation to buffer amplification.

Whether you're designing medical instruments, industrial control systems, or audio equipment, the LT1179SW#PBF delivers the performance and efficiency required to meet your project's demands.
